## Runbook: GC pauses in Pairwise matcher

Symptom: match latency spikes above 2s, queue depth climbs, then recovers. Cause is almost always a full GC pause on the Pairwise matching service in the Dunmore cluster.

First response: check heap occupancy on the affected node. Above 85%, restart the node — do not wait for it to recover. Below 85%, escalate to the Pairwise team; do not restart, they need the heap dump.

The GC and heap settings the service currently runs with are shown below.

config for bahof-tagep:
kelael:
  pin: 3701
  tenant: fraius
  seal: seal_566287a7
  metrics_host: metrics.kelael.ferradyn.local
  standby_team: sormir
  escalation: juldor-oliir
  nonce: 530523

The garage occupancy feed for the Brindlewood campus arrives over a message queue every thirty seconds, one record per level, published by the Stallgrid edge boxes. Counts can briefly go negative when a sensor double-fires on exit; the ingest job clamps these to zero and flags the interval. If the feed stalls for more than five minutes, the dashboard falls back to the last known snapshot. Sensor mappings, queue names, and the replay procedure are documented on the internal page below.

runbook for tahog-kadug: https://gitlab.qirvanworks.corp/projects/pages/view/b139298aed28

Health checks at Brindlewood run behind the Corven load balancer. Each service exposes /healthz; Corven polls every 10s, drops a node after 3 failures. Do not return 200 while dependencies are down — use 503 so traffic drains cleanly. Deep checks live at /readyz and gate deploys. If the whole pool drains and you're locked out of the Corven console, use the break-glass account with the passphrase below.

strongbox words: zordor-quenax